I used to have the helical LSD...
I never drove my car (after the engine conversion) without an LSD but to be honest I don't think it worked wonders. I wouldn't spin the inside wheel but I think that was more due to really good tires, really good suspension, and lack of any real power. I think the issue with helical LSD's is that all they do is somewhat hinder the natural tendency to single spin, however once it does spin one wheel it'll keep going like an open diff.
In contrast I have a Cusco 1.5 way right now which works a million times better, and is actually really impressive however it isn't "smooth" and seems really hardcore. I did try to put 1 wheel on grass and 1 wheel on pavement and launched it and still had impressive traction without single spinning
